… | |
… | |
47 | <p><strong>rxvt</strong> [options] [-e command [ args ]]</p> |
47 | <p><strong>rxvt</strong> [options] [-e command [ args ]]</p> |
48 | <p> |
48 | <p> |
49 | </p> |
49 | </p> |
50 | <hr /> |
50 | <hr /> |
51 | <h1><a name="description">DESCRIPTION</a></h1> |
51 | <h1><a name="description">DESCRIPTION</a></h1> |
52 | <p><strong>rxvt-unicode</strong>, version <strong>5.2</strong>, is a colour vt102 terminal |
52 | <p><strong>rxvt-unicode</strong>, version <strong>5.3</strong>, is a colour vt102 terminal |
53 | emulator intended as an <em>xterm</em>(1) replacement for users who do not |
53 | emulator intended as an <em>xterm</em>(1) replacement for users who do not |
54 | require features such as Tektronix 4014 emulation and toolkit-style |
54 | require features such as Tektronix 4014 emulation and toolkit-style |
55 | configurability. As a result, <strong>rxvt-unicode</strong> uses much less swap space -- |
55 | configurability. As a result, <strong>rxvt-unicode</strong> uses much less swap space -- |
56 | a significant advantage on a machine serving many X sessions.</p> |
56 | a significant advantage on a machine serving many X sessions.</p> |
57 | <p> |
57 | <p> |
… | |
… | |
545 | <p>Here is a short Gtk2-perl snippet that illustrates how this option can be |
545 | <p>Here is a short Gtk2-perl snippet that illustrates how this option can be |
546 | used (a longer example is in <em>doc/embed</em>):</p> |
546 | used (a longer example is in <em>doc/embed</em>):</p> |
547 | </dd> |
547 | </dd> |
548 | <dd> |
548 | <dd> |
549 | <pre> |
549 | <pre> |
550 | my $rxvt = new Gtk2::DrawingArea; |
550 | my $rxvt = new Gtk2::Socket; |
551 | $...->add ($rxvt); # important to add it somewhere first |
551 | $rxvt->signal_connect_after (realize => sub { |
552 | $rxvt->realize; # now it can be realized |
|
|
553 | my $xid = $rxvt->window->get_xid;</pre> |
552 | my $xid = $_[0]->window->get_xid; |
554 | </dd> |
|
|
555 | <dd> |
|
|
556 | <pre> |
|
|
557 | system "rxvt -embed $xid &";</pre> |
553 | system "rxvt -embed $xid &"; |
|
|
554 | });</pre> |
558 | </dd> |
555 | </dd> |
559 | <p></p> |
556 | <p></p> |
560 | <dt><strong><a name="item__2dpty_2dfd_fileno"><strong>-pty-fd</strong> <em>fileno</em></a></strong><br /> |
557 | <dt><strong><a name="item__2dpty_2dfd_fileno"><strong>-pty-fd</strong> <em>fileno</em></a></strong><br /> |
561 | </dt> |
558 | </dt> |
562 | <dd> |
559 | <dd> |
… | |
… | |
580 | use Fcntl;</pre> |
577 | use Fcntl;</pre> |
581 | </dd> |
578 | </dd> |
582 | <dd> |
579 | <dd> |
583 | <pre> |
580 | <pre> |
584 | my $pty = new IO::Pty; |
581 | my $pty = new IO::Pty; |
585 | fcntl $pty, F_SETFD, 0; # clear close-on-exec</pre> |
582 | fcntl $pty, F_SETFD, 0; # clear close-on-exec |
586 | </dd> |
|
|
587 | <dd> |
|
|
588 | <pre> |
|
|
589 | system "rxvt -pty-fd " . (fileno $pty) . "&";</pre> |
583 | system "rxvt -pty-fd " . (fileno $pty) . "&"; |
|
|
584 | close $pty;</pre> |
590 | </dd> |
585 | </dd> |
591 | <dd> |
586 | <dd> |
592 | <pre> |
587 | <pre> |
593 | # now communicate with rxvt |
588 | # now communicate with rxvt |
594 | my $slave = $pty->slave; |
589 | my $slave = $pty->slave; |
… | |
… | |
1100 | </dd> |
1095 | </dd> |
1101 | <p></p> |
1096 | <p></p> |
1102 | <dt><strong><a name="item_pointerblankdelay_3a_number"><strong>pointerBlankDelay:</strong> <em>number</em></a></strong><br /> |
1097 | <dt><strong><a name="item_pointerblankdelay_3a_number"><strong>pointerBlankDelay:</strong> <em>number</em></a></strong><br /> |
1103 | </dt> |
1098 | </dt> |
1104 | <dd> |
1099 | <dd> |
1105 | Specifies number of seconds before blanking the pointer [default 2]. |
1100 | Specifies number of seconds before blanking the pointer [default 2]. Use a |
|
|
1101 | large number (e.g. <code>987654321</code>) to effectively disable the timeout. |
1106 | </dd> |
1102 | </dd> |
1107 | <p></p> |
1103 | <p></p> |
1108 | <dt><strong><a name="item_backspacekey_3a_string"><strong>backspacekey:</strong> <em>string</em></a></strong><br /> |
1104 | <dt><strong><a name="item_backspacekey_3a_string"><strong>backspacekey:</strong> <em>string</em></a></strong><br /> |
1109 | </dt> |
1105 | </dt> |
1110 | <dd> |
1106 | <dd> |